Here we’ll discuss what a fixed deposit is, and how it can help you in the long run What exactly is a Fixed Deposit? Essentially, a fixed deposit (FD) is nothing but an investment account in which a sum of money is deposited for a specific amount of time at a fixed interest rate. The account is inaccessible through the duration of the pre-determined time. This means that you cannot withdraw, or deposit any money in a fixed deposit amount till it has reached its maturity date. FDs are a safer option than other investment types such as share trading, where there is a huge profit involved, but with little security and guarantee. Interest Rates Now that we know what a fixed deposit is, let’s try and understand the interest policies that work behind an FD account. The rate of interest on an FD is higher than that of a typical savings account since the maturity period is often longer and the money is essentially locked in. To determine the interest rate of a Fixed Deposit account, you can use the Fixed Deposit calculator. The calculator also makes it easy to compare the differences in interest receivable by changing the tenure, interest payment frequency or deposit amount.

  2. Why Should You Invest in a Fixed Deposit? An FD is a great way to secure money for the future. Since your money is locked in, even from yourself, it’s a guarantee that the deposit isn’t going anywhere. There are, however, emergency withdrawals that are possible should you face any sort of financial crisis. Furthermore, should you choose to open an FD, you have the option of 6 flexible tenures to choose from. Other benefits include an extra 0.25% on the interest rates for senior citizens and online access to your FD account. How to Invest in Fixed Deposit? Fixed deposits have been highly popular, due to their safety of capital and surety of return. So, how exactly do you go about creating one? You can open an FD account all by yourself or even through your firm or family. However, depending on the city in which you live, the minimum required amount for opening an FD may vary between INR 50000 to INR 150000.
